Medavie Health Services West (MHS West) Shamrock proudly provides emergency and medical services in Wadena, Wynyard, Foam Lake and Rose Valley, Saskatchewan. Together with our team of professionals, we are committed to improving the wellbeing of Canadians.

Shamrock is responsible for delivering innovative EMS solutions focused on bringing high-quality care to patients when and where they need it. Since 1978, the team has grown to serve the individual communities by offering basic and advanced life support service delivery.

Shamrock, nestled into the heart of the Saskatchewan prairie landscape halfway between Saskatoon and Yorkton. With busy lake communities nearby at Quill Lake, Fishing Lake and Barrier Lakes, lake life joins a mixed agricultural community providing a relaxed rural experience with many amenities. As a whole, Shamrock's call volume is 2500 annually, and the service has a peak catchment of 30,000.

Shamrock Ambulance Services is currently looking for Paramedics (ACP/PCP) to fill full-time, part-time, and casual positions. Subject to client needs, ACP hours are 07:00 - 09:00 standby hours, 09:00 - 21:00 regular hours, and 21:00 - 07:00 standby hours. PCP hours are 07:00 - 09:00 standby hours, 09:00 - 17:00 regular hours, and 17:00 - 07:00 standby hours.

The position entails, but is not limited to the following:



Independent primary clinical care. Safe transportation of individuals, including emergency and non-emergency responses, as well as inter-facility transfers. Maintain and operate ambulances and related equipment in accordance with patient needs and public safety. Clinical expectations and responsibilities for Primary Care Paramedics are based on the current National Occupational Competency Profile (NOCP), the Saskatchewan College of Paramedics registration requirements and Medavie Health Services West policies, procedures and protocols.
